Reducing Bushing - Multi-Step Reducing Fitting

Reducing Bushings provide a size transition between a male and female thread, often available in multiple standard reduction steps for flexible fitting combinations.

Technical Specifications

GradeSS 304/316, CS A105, Alloy Steel (as specified)
Size Range1/4" x 1/8" - 4" x 1/2" NB
Pressure Class2000 / 3000 / 6000 LBS
End ConnectionMale x Female NPT/BSPT
FinishBlack / Bright / Galvanized
StandardsASME B16.11, MSS SP-79
Available GradesSS 304/316, CS A105, Alloy Steel (as specified)
